The microdrama centers on Kishika Mehra, a hardworking medical student burdened by immense financial hardship to fund her brother's medical treatment. Her life irrevocably intertwines with Vikrant Singh, the enigmatic and powerful CEO of a pharmaceutical empire, when he discovers her deceased father was a major debtor to his company. Driven by a desire for control, Vikrant traps Kishika, asserting dominance over her through the inherited debt and making scandalous propositions, which she defiantly rejects while seeking independence. Their volatile relationship is complicated by the emergence of Siddharth, who has a mysterious connection to both, and Varun, who offers Kishika a chance at freedom. As Kishika navigates Vikrant's possessive demands and accusations, a confidante reveals his hidden compassionate past, challenging her perception of his ruthless corporate actions. Despite her attempts to break free, Vikrant refuses to let her go, proposing a new, controlling arrangement. The narrative escalates with Vikrant facing a brutal attack and revealing his manipulative nature, secretly paying for a child's medical bills as leverage. Meanwhile, Kishika's romantic entanglements deepen, including a fiery romance with Yash and a tender, yet challenged, connection with Vikrant, who juggles multiple relationships. Kishika is repeatedly put in peril, abducted by various figures, while Vikrant is forced into a contract marriage with the terminally ill Mallika, who later selflessly divorces him to guide him back to Kishika. The central conflict intensifies with the revelation of Siddharth as Vikrant's disinherited younger brother, driven by a lifetime of neglect and a dark secret of illegitimacy. Siddharth orchestrates elaborate schemes, using Kishika as a pawn in his quest for retribution and power against Vikrant. His manipulative revenge plot, which involves a calculated romance with Kishika, culminates in a violent act and a dramatic cliffhanger. Years later, Vikrant's peaceful life is shattered when Siddharth mysteriously vanishes after transferring a significant company share to him, leaving Vikrant to unravel his brother's disappearance and confront their complex history amidst corporate intrigue.
